The unfortunate death of Kobe Bryant, his daughter and seven others will make for a surreal experience at the Staples Center Friday night on ESPN.

The Los Angeles Lakers have not played since last Saturday in Philadelphia. The Lakers franchise and players face a monumental task of trying to memorialize Kobe Bryant in the proper way and still keep emotions in check to win a game.

No active player will have taken Kobe’s passing harder than LeBron. James' play will set the tone for his team and the emotion for Anthony Davis, Kyle Kuzma and others will be unfathomable.

Let’s not forget about the Lakers’ older players, all in their 30’s, who played against Bryant, like Dwight Howard, Danny Green, Rajon Rondo, JaVale McGee and Jared Dudley. For them, this contest will also have a special meaning.

LA Lakers free pickLakers coach Frank Vogel said Thursday, "We want to represent what Kobe was about." Vogel understands his team will have to play through the grief with the best record in the Western Conference at 36-10 (24-21-1 ATS). But professional athletes are well known for compartmentalizing and that is what the coach is counting on. Besides, Vogel and his staff have to figure out how to slow down Portland’s Damian Lillard, who is blazing H O T!

Lillard was named the NBA’s Western Conference Player of the Week after averaging 52.7 points over a three-game stretch. He followed that up Wednesday by scoring 36 points to go along with 10 rebounds and 11 assists, in a victory over Houston. That was the first triple-double of Lillard’s distinguished career.  This kept the Blazers (21-27 SU, 18-28-2 ATS) three games behind Memphis for the No. 8 slot in the West.

"He’s (Lillard) been locked in," Blazers guard CJ McCollum said. "He’s been playing at an elite level. I think this is the best basketball that he’s played in his career, which is saying a lot." The 29-year old Weber State product is the first player in Portland history to score 30-plus points in six consecutive games.
